NEW YORK, April 21 (GenomeWeb News) - the US Food and Drug Administration is soliciting gene expression datasets from microarray experiments as part of its MicroArray Quality Control (MAQC) posted on the FDA website, FDA said that it is seeking datasets "as well as proposals to analyze these datasets in order to evaluate the impact of different analysis protocols on the selection of genes and their associated signatures for biomarker pattern development." 数据挖掘研究院
The FDA′s National Center for Toxicological Research is collecting the datasets and proposals for participation in the project. The evaluation process is open to the public, FDA said. 数据挖掘实验室
The MAQC project involves six FDA centers, several microarray vendors, government agencies, and academic labs that are working to develop "baseline practices for the analysis of hybridization data," the FDA said. 数据挖掘研究院
